WebJun 5, 2024 · Lower your thermostat. As we mentioned above, warmer air contains more moisture. If you are like most Canadian household, you can probably afford to turn the thermostat down a degree or two and still be comfortable. As a result, you may see a decrease in humidity and condensation. Use your fans. WebApr 30, 2024 · 2. Open the drapes. WebOct 1, 2024 · If you use a room on a regular basis, such as a living room and the weather is not cold outside, open a window slightly to improve the ventilation in the room. Breathing is one of the main causes of condensation so this will help to improve the ventilation in your property. 9. Wipe Down Cold Surfaces. taxi stambula
